April is Autism Awareness and Acceptance Month! According to the Centers for Disease Control, autism affects an estimated 1 in 54 children in the United States today. Autism is a spectrum disorder, meaning that each person with Autism has distinct strengths and challenges unique to them.
Our team waited to share some video clips provided by Joy Fehring, our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D) specialist. The videos may help broaden our understanding and acceptance of ASD.

We are excited to share that we have partnered with Every Meal (formerly Sheridan Project) to provide meals for families in need at DaVinci. This program is free for all families at DaVinci in grades K-8, there is no income qualification, and there is no private information collected.
Families who sign up will receive a 3-5 pound bag of food each week for each school age child they sign up. Families will need to complete a separate form for each child they are enrolling. There are 5 different types of meal bags available for families to choose from which can be viewed here. Families can sign all of their children up for the same type of bag or they can sign up for different bags, depending on preference. Meal bags will be placed in your student’s backpack on the last day of each week. Families can sign up or cancel at any time as their needs change.

Student Illnesses:
We are thankful to see a decline in COVID cases, but we are unfortunately seeing an increase in colds, stomach flu, and other illnesses. Please continue to assess your child each day for symptoms and if they are feeling well enough to make it through the school day. In addition, if your child has a fever, vomiting, or diarrhea, they will need to be free of these symptoms for at least 24 hours without the use of medications before returning to school.

Boosters Recommended for People Aged 12 and Older
As a reminder, the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) announced now recommend booster shots for those aged 12 and older five months after the completion of the primary series of Pfizer-BioNTech COVID-19 vaccine. In addition, for some immunocompromised children aged 5-11 years old, CDC also recommends an additional dose of the Pfizer-BioNTech COVID-19 vaccine to complete the primary series – a total of three doses.
